{
delete items_.at(i);
items_.removeAt(i);
- break;
+ return;
}
}
}
void ThemeScheduler::store()
{
+ Settings::instance().setValue("theme_scheduler_enabled", enabled_);
+
if(items_.isEmpty())
{
Settings::instance().remove("theme_scheduler");
emit themeChanged();
}
}
+
+bool ThemeScheduler::isEmpty() const
+{
+ return items_.isEmpty();
+}